Name: Joseph Washington
AKA: Joe Wash, Downtown Joe, DT
Date of Affiliation: April 7, 1997
Status: Active

Background: Joe's stint in the Army might have let him be all that he could be, but it didn't exactly prepare him for the real world. He returned to his native Los Angeles, at a loss for what to do. He drifted into odd jobs, and eventually found himself working as a bellhop at the Beverly Hills Hilton. The work seemed to suit him. Not the carrying bags part -- anybody could do that. But Joe always kept his ears open, and was able to help the guests out, help them find things, places, people; help them make the connections they needed.

Joe stayed away from the really illegal stuff; he didn't hook folks up with drugs, for example. But if you needed to score a couple of invites to the hot party in town, if you wanted to known where to go to see and be seen, if you had to "bump into" that certain director, and wanted to know where he'd be eating that night, Joe was your go-to guy. He knew just about anything that was going down in LA or Hollywood.

It went deeper than that. If you needed to "borrow" a hot car for a date (or a job), Joe could hook you up. Safe houses, street docs, hardware, it didn't matter. He was Mr. Downtown, and his fingers were on everyone's pulse.

He stepped on some toes along the way; it was bound to happen. Juan San Lucas was not amused when DT "lent" the crimelord's limo to a friend for a quick ride down the coast and reached out to crush the foolish fixer like a bug. It was a miscalculation on San Lucas' part.

Mr. Downtown had been turned onto the Blackboard by a grateful client, and had been helping its users fill their LA needs. Now, he turned to it for some help of his own. He got the Four Horsemen riding to his rescue. The five of them put San Lucas down for good, but pissed off the rest of the Diego-San Lucas Crime Organization even more. No big deal to the Horsemen; they were used to it. But it was more heat than DT was used to. He started hanging out with the Horsies more and more, and became their eyes on the street. When the Blackboard got even more organized, Mr. Downtown was there to be a part of it.

Skills: Mr. Downtown is the ultimate source for information in LA and its surroundings. If you need to find out something, he's the first place to check. He's also an excellent scrounger and can come up with almost anything, given time. A lot of strange stuff finds its way to LA, and Mr. Downtown can get his hands on it.

DT was an 11-Bravo in this man's army, and is comfortable with rifles, pistols, grenades, machine-guns, and small mortars. In addition, he's gotten used to shotguns and SMGs. He's not the combat star that many of his compatriots are, but he can certainly hold his own. He's had his share of street scuffles, but he's not a train martial artist. He leaves that stuff to folks like Rudy, who are psycho enough to get good at it.
